Transaction 3af9265a08341acb4deae31e2c0875619cb737f3828e6f8734d59e0b800476aa
1 Input
1 Output
-
3af9265a08341acb4deae31e2c0875619cb737f3828e6f8734d59e0b800476aa:0
- value
- 2169064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 efb9c77b2a31fc8419a019f57e16f46689ec83f2 OP_EQUAL
- address
- 3PYZyZKAUw7wbme7eFQB8gaSFHZG88YKb4